
在数据分析中,不同的回归模型可以通过线性回归、逻辑回归、岭回归、拉索回归、弹性网回归等方法来使用。其中,线性回归是最基础且最常用的回归分析方法。它通过最小化预测值与实际值之间的误差平方和来拟合数据,适用于预测连续型变量。FineBI是一款强大的商业智能工具,能够轻松实现各种回归模型的数据分析。FineBI官网: https://s.fanruan.com/f459r;。
一、线性回归
线性回归是最常用的回归分析方法之一,适用于预测连续型变量。线性回归通过最小化预测值与实际值之间的误差平方和来拟合数据。具体步骤包括:数据准备、特征选择、模型训练和模型评估。数据准备阶段需要清洗数据,处理缺失值和异常值。特征选择阶段需要选择与目标变量相关性较强的特征。模型训练阶段使用训练数据拟合模型,模型评估阶段使用测试数据评估模型性能。FineBI作为一款商业智能工具,可以通过图形化界面实现线性回归分析,简化了操作流程。
二、逻辑回归
逻辑回归主要用于分类问题,适用于预测二分类或多分类变量。逻辑回归通过最大化似然函数来拟合数据。具体步骤包括:数据准备、特征选择、模型训练和模型评估。数据准备阶段需要清洗数据,处理缺失值和异常值。特征选择阶段需要选择与目标变量相关性较强的特征。模型训练阶段使用训练数据拟合模型,模型评估阶段使用测试数据评估模型性能。FineBI可以通过图形化界面实现逻辑回归分析,简化了操作流程。
三、岭回归
岭回归是一种改进的线性回归方法,适用于解决多重共线性问题。岭回归通过在损失函数中加入L2正则化项来约束模型参数,防止过拟合。具体步骤包括:数据准备、特征选择、模型训练和模型评估。数据准备阶段需要清洗数据,处理缺失值和异常值。特征选择阶段需要选择与目标变量相关性较强的特征。模型训练阶段使用训练数据拟合模型,模型评估阶段使用测试数据评估模型性能。FineBI可以通过图形化界面实现岭回归分析,简化了操作流程。
四、拉索回归
拉索回归是一种改进的线性回归方法,适用于解决高维度数据问题。拉索回归通过在损失函数中加入L1正则化项来约束模型参数,防止过拟合并实现特征选择。具体步骤包括:数据准备、特征选择、模型训练和模型评估。数据准备阶段需要清洗数据,处理缺失值和异常值。特征选择阶段需要选择与目标变量相关性较强的特征。模型训练阶段使用训练数据拟合模型,模型评估阶段使用测试数据评估模型性能。FineBI可以通过图形化界面实现拉索回归分析,简化了操作流程。
五、弹性网回归
弹性网回归结合了岭回归和拉索回归的优点,适用于解决多重共线性和高维度数据问题。弹性网回归通过在损失函数中同时加入L1和L2正则化项来约束模型参数,防止过拟合并实现特征选择。具体步骤包括:数据准备、特征选择、模型训练和模型评估。数据准备阶段需要清洗数据,处理缺失值和异常值。特征选择阶段需要选择与目标变量相关性较强的特征。模型训练阶段使用训练数据拟合模型,模型评估阶段使用测试数据评估模型性能。FineBI可以通过图形化界面实现弹性网回归分析,简化了操作流程。
六、FineBI在回归分析中的应用
FineBI作为一款强大的商业智能工具,可以轻松实现各种回归模型的数据分析。通过图形化界面,用户可以快速完成数据准备、特征选择、模型训练和模型评估等步骤。FineBI支持多种回归模型,包括线性回归、逻辑回归、岭回归、拉索回归和弹性网回归。用户可以根据具体需求选择合适的回归模型,并通过可视化界面进行数据分析和结果展示。FineBI还支持自动化数据处理和模型优化,帮助用户提高分析效率和预测准确性。FineBI官网: https://s.fanruan.com/f459r;。
七、回归模型的选择和优化
在选择回归模型时,需要根据数据特征和分析目的进行选择。线性回归适用于预测连续型变量,逻辑回归适用于分类问题,岭回归适用于解决多重共线性问题,拉索回归适用于高维度数据,弹性网回归适用于同时解决多重共线性和高维度数据问题。选择合适的回归模型后,还需要对模型进行优化,包括数据处理、特征选择、模型参数调整等。FineBI可以通过自动化数据处理和模型优化功能,帮助用户提高分析效率和预测准确性。
八、数据准备和特征选择
数据准备是回归分析的基础,数据质量直接影响模型性能。数据准备包括数据清洗、处理缺失值和异常值等。特征选择是回归分析的关键步骤,选择与目标变量相关性较强的特征可以提高模型的预测准确性。FineBI通过图形化界面,可以方便地进行数据清洗和特征选择,帮助用户快速完成数据准备和特征选择。
九、模型训练和评估
模型训练是回归分析的核心步骤,通过训练数据拟合模型。模型评估是验证模型性能的重要步骤,通过测试数据评估模型的预测准确性。FineBI支持多种回归模型的训练和评估,用户可以通过图形化界面轻松完成模型训练和评估,快速获得分析结果。
十、FineBI的可视化和报告功能
FineBI提供丰富的可视化和报告功能,用户可以通过图形化界面展示分析结果,生成专业的分析报告。FineBI支持多种图表类型,包括折线图、柱状图、散点图等,用户可以根据需要选择合适的图表类型展示分析结果。FineBI还支持自动化报告生成和分享功能,帮助用户提高工作效率和协作效果。FineBI官网: https://s.fanruan.com/f459r;。
相关问答FAQs:
不同的回归模型有哪些适用场景?
回归模型是数据分析中常用的工具,主要用于预测和解释变量之间的关系。不同的回归模型适用于不同类型的数据和研究目的。线性回归是最基础的回归模型,适合用于自变量和因变量之间呈线性关系的情况。多元回归则适合用于多个自变量影响一个因变量的情况,能够提供更复杂的分析。
当数据中存在非线性关系时,使用多项式回归或其他非线性回归模型会更合适。例如,多项式回归能够通过增加自变量的幂次来拟合复杂的曲线。此外,岭回归和Lasso回归等正则化技术可用于处理多重共线性问题,尤其在自变量之间存在高度相关性时,这些模型能够提高预测的稳定性和解释性。
对于分类问题,逻辑回归是一种常用的选择,尽管它的名称中包含“回归”,但它实际上是用于二分类或多分类问题的。逻辑回归能够帮助分析某个事件发生的概率,适用于医疗、金融等领域的风险评估。
如何选择合适的回归模型进行数据分析?
选择合适的回归模型进行数据分析,首先需要了解数据的特性和分析目标。数据的分布、变量之间的关系以及潜在的影响因素都会影响模型的选择。进行初步的数据探索性分析(EDA)是关键的一步,通过可视化手段如散点图、热力图等,能够直观地观察自变量与因变量之间的关系。
在确定模型之前,数据预处理也是一个重要环节。处理缺失值、异常值以及标准化自变量等,能够提高模型的性能。依据数据的性质,选择线性或非线性模型,或者在多元回归中引入交互项和多项式项,都是有效的策略。
在实际应用中,模型的评估同样至关重要。通过交叉验证、AIC/BIC信息准则等方法对模型进行评估,确保选择的模型具有良好的预测能力和泛化能力。此外,模型的解释性也是考虑因素之一,尤其是在需要向非专业人士解释分析结果时,选择简单易懂的模型会更加有效。
如何利用回归模型进行实际数据分析?
在进行实际数据分析时,首先要明确分析的目的和问题。例如,是否希望预测未来的趋势,还是希望了解某些因素对结果的影响。明确目标后,收集相关数据是关键的一步。数据的来源可以是历史记录、问卷调查、传感器数据等,确保数据的质量和完整性是分析成功的基础。
在数据收集完成后,需要进行数据清洗和准备。处理缺失值、异常值和数据类型转换等操作,能够为后续的模型建立打下良好的基础。接下来,进行探索性数据分析,通过可视化手段了解数据的分布特征,识别潜在的变量关系,为模型选择提供依据。
建立回归模型后,进行模型训练和验证是关键步骤。根据训练数据拟合模型,并用验证集评估模型的预测性能。常用的评价指标包括均方误差(MSE)、决定系数(R²)等,能够帮助判断模型的优劣。
完成模型评估后,便可以应用模型进行实际预测和分析。在得到预测结果后,可以通过可视化手段将结果呈现,帮助相关决策者理解分析结果,从而制定更合理的策略和决策。数据分析的过程是一个循环的过程,随着新数据的加入和分析目标的改变,模型也需要不断调整和优化。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



